How can I add "..." to GUI.Label if it goes past its bounds?

Answer by Scribe · Jun 08, 2013 at 11:49 PM

I made this a while ago, not sure its particularly efficient but it appears to do the job!

 var myString : String;
 private var tempString : String;
 private var stringSize : Vector2;
 var labelWidth = 100;
 
 function Start () {
     if(labelWidth < 15){
         labelWidth = 15;
     }
 }
 
 function OnGUI () {
     myString = GUI.TextField(Rect(10, 10, 300, 20), myString);
     stringSize = GUI.skin.GetStyle("Box").CalcSize(GUIContent(myString));
     
     if(stringSize.x > labelWidth){
         CalcSubstring();
         GUI.Label(Rect(10, 40, labelWidth, 20), tempString + "...");
     }else{
         GUI.Label(Rect(10, 40, labelWidth, 20), myString);
     }
 }
 
 function CalcSubstring () {
     tempString = myString;
     while(GUI.skin.GetStyle("Box").CalcSize(GUIContent(tempString)).x > labelWidth-8){
         tempString = tempString.Substring(0, tempString.Length - 1);
     }
 }
